Summary: | Jakarta Globe, 30 June 2009, more than half from several students in Jakarta
never heard about the black history of Indonesia in 1965-1966. They never know about
the massive murdered of Partai Komunis Indonesia (Indonesian Communist Party). In
Indonesian history still written that the communists are the rebel who want to change
the state�s ideology, Pancasila. All that we know just communist is the bad, and they
have to be destroyed. Young people who hate but doesn�t know much about the another
version is the modern victim of history.
Mwathirika� is a puppet theater performance from Papermoon Puppet Theater.
It record memories through another version, beside the state�s version. It tells about
two family who live in peace eventhough they are in different political side. This show
is a new way to presentated rememoration discourse. This research will describe the
retelling process about the history of 1965 tragedy in a different perspective through
puppet theatre
History often connected with the state political interests. The fact is, history are
used and abused by state to legitimate the authority. History is the winner�s, but each
people have their own memories. And some of their memories are distinguish because
of their memories are not in the same line of state interests. This forgotten memories
are the one that have to striven for. Because each people have the right to have their
own memories and free to tell their own story. Papermoon make this puppet
performance, as an art, to tell some of the forgotten memories � through their point of
view. Puppet performance can be a good way to tell the history of 1965, without
considered as a taboo in Indonesia.
